Transaction 921850a4f7af6886dd93e8dd152c66e2bb94e43c9fbefb3a7c959e6102134e60

1 Input
2 Outputs
  • 921850a4f7af6886dd93e8dd152c66e2bb94e43c9fbefb3a7c959e6102134e60:0
  • value  1404700
    address  3CaoBW6tDudS3YuimtWUU73tVMCwoyNvya
  • 921850a4f7af6886dd93e8dd152c66e2bb94e43c9fbefb3a7c959e6102134e60:1
  • value  306547040
    address  bc1q6652hnp0e5psmlhsa5rz9vlwyxwy5lv0zp3ls9